The median sale price settles at $295,000, reinforcing accessibility without compromising property value.
Market Dynamics for All in January 2026
Lowell, IN boasts 43 active listings and 22 fresh options for buyers right at the start of the year. Sellers are closing at or near their asking prices, with a 97 percent list-to-sale ratio. If you are wondering "is it a good time to buy in Lowell, IN?", facts such as a 2.3 months absorption rate and an average 47 days on market support a confident yes—there is genuine opportunity and movement for all involved.

Active buyers should be aware that 37 percent of sales this January fell into the price range of $250,000 to $300,000, giving them a clear reference point for buying decisions.
